    I am sorry to hear about the lost armour. Last time I also have a set that lost a brick so I just go to the following website and complete the part replacement page. If you got lost or broken parts you can go to the following website:

    http://us.service.lego.com/en-GB/replacementparts/default.aspx

    But the part replacement takes around 2weeks as the website is in USA. They will mail you your missing parts. In the meantime you can also contact lego singapore too.

  4. Hippo on July 14th, 2010

    By the way last time I received my lost part free, no postage cost. They bear the postage cost. Do let me know your progress. Hope you get the king’s armour soon.
